Recent form
Coventry City
Coventry City have been in impressive form recently, winning five consecutive matches before their latest defeat to Derby County. This remarkable run saw them climb to 6th position in the Championship, firmly in the play-off spots. The Sky Blues have been particularly potent in attack, scoring 11 goals in their last six games, with an average of 1.83 goals per match. Their 3-2 victory over Stoke City stands out as a high-scoring encounter, showcasing their attacking prowess. However, Coventry's defence has been somewhat leaky, conceding in five consecutive matches and keeping only one clean sheet in this period. Despite this, their goal difference remains positive, and they've managed to outscore opponents in most games. The team's ability to consistently find the back of the net is evident, with 67% of their recent matches seeing both teams score and 67% featuring over 2.5 goals.
Sunderland
Sunderland have shown mixed form in their recent fixtures, currently sitting in a respectable 4th position in the Championship with 69 points from 37 games. The Black Cats have managed three wins, one draw, and two losses in their last six matches, demonstrating their ability to bounce back from setbacks. Their goal-scoring record has been steady, netting 8 goals in these games for an average of 1.33 per match, whilst conceding 6 goals. Notably, Sunderland have struggled to keep clean sheets, with their last one coming five games ago against Luton Town. The team's matches have been evenly split between high and low-scoring affairs, with 50% of their recent games seeing over 2.5 goals. Interestingly, both teams have scored in two-thirds of Sunderland's last six matches, suggesting their games are often competitive and entertaining for neutrals.

Recent home/away form
Coventry City
Coventry City have shown impressive home form recently, winning their last three Championship matches at the Coventry Building Society Arena. This run of victories has contributed significantly to their current 6th position in the league. Despite a couple of setbacks, including a heavy 4-1 defeat to Ipswich Town in the FA Cup, the Sky Blues have bounced back strongly in the league. Their home matches have been high-scoring affairs, with 67% of games seeing over 2.5 goals and both teams scoring in two-thirds of the fixtures. The standout result was the thrilling 3-2 victory over Stoke City, showcasing Coventry's ability to outscore opponents in closely contested matches. While their goal difference over the last six home games is slightly negative, their attacking prowess is evident, having scored an average of 1.5 goals per game in this period.
Sunderland
Sunderland have shown mixed form away from home in their recent Championship fixtures, with three wins, one draw, and two losses in their last six away matches. The Black Cats have demonstrated resilience on the road, securing back-to-back victories in their two most recent away games against Sheffield Wednesday and Middlesbrough. Their encounter with Middlesbrough was particularly high-scoring, ending in a 3-2 triumph for Sunderland. Defensively, the team have been relatively solid, conceding an average of just one goal per game in their last six away matches and keeping two clean sheets. Despite their inconsistent results, Sunderland have managed to maintain a positive goal difference and currently sit in 4th position in the league, showcasing their ability to compete effectively away from home.
